Wo beginnt die Lebensdauer einer Swift iOS-Anwendung?
Wenn ich eine Objective-C iOS-Anwendung in Xcode erstelle, wird eine Datei mit dem Namenmain.m
wird generiert. Der Inhalt der Datei sieht ungefähr so aus:
#import <UIKit/UIKit.h>
#import "AppDelegate.h"
int main(int argc, char * argv[]) {
@autoreleasepool {
return UIApplicationMain(argc, argv, nil, NSStringFromClass([AppDelegate class]));
}
}
Und hier beginnt das Leben einer Objective-C iOS-Anwendung.
Wichtig, wenn ich eine Unterklasse von @ erstellen möchUIApplication
(aus welchem Grund auch immer), dannHie ist der Ort, an dem ich meiner App mitteile, welche Klasse für die Anwendungsklasse verwendet werden soll. Wenn ich aus irgendeinem Grund einen anderen Klassennamen als @ verwenden möchtAppDelegate
Für meine App würde ich diese Informationen hier ändern.
JEDOC, wenn ich eine Swift iOS-Anwendung in Xcode erstelle, wird keine solche Datei generiert (die ich finden konnte). Wo stelle ich diese Dinge auf?